Well they said they wanted to record together. They probably have. I'd imagine they have a whole library of stuff they've worked on together but don't want to release because of timing. Making a record doesn't make you money anyways... It's the touring that does that, and they would have to tour together with the baby, which might not be the best idea considering he's not even one yet.

Raine will probably produce Chantal's next album (if and whenever that happens), and we'd probably see a few songs done together on that as a seguay into a complete album done together.

Music is a business when you get down to it. It's all about money. If it wasn't, no one would sign to labels. The second you sign to a label, or tour, its about the money. If anyone tells you different, you might want to give your head a shake.

i dont believe in the "Sell Out" term... sorry

i feel that if a fan cared about more than just music (which some of you may not) then personal success would be wanted for the artist or band. and "going commercial" is this generations way of being successful. this isnt 10 years ago, this is 2004 and to become successful you have to sell and aim at a range of markets. otherwise you'll go bankrupt and fail at selling a good album.

i think...?

20 years ago, it was the same. theres just different people and ways of selling a record. nowadays theres MTV and VH1 and all these many many ways of being seen.

id personally, like to see Our Lady Peace be successful with this next album. if its their last. and if they're not aiming it at their 1997 audience then so be it. id rather they be happy and do what they want and be rewarded for it than have old fans complain about the music and not help them in progression

You obviously have to make money to survive. A band could not last if they weren't making money as they would need to eat, have somewhere to live, etc. I'm talking about the common band as well. Not just Raine and Chantal.

Obviously the initial intention is to play music for the love of it. But eventually it comes to a point where if you're going to do that for a living you actually have to be making money and ensure that money will keep coming in. That's when it become a business/career.
